Selina Scott and Tony Francis visit three places whose past was linked to flowers. Tony Francis digs up the history of lavender production in the Surrey suburbs and meets the people reviving the tradition. Plus the Shropshire town with a sweet pea passion, and where the name Saffron Walden came from. [S]
